Understanding the Role of a Psychiatrist
Psychiatrists are medical doctors concentrating on mental health. They diagnose, deal with, and handle numerous mental health conditions, which can consist of depression, stress and anxiety, bipolar illness, schizophrenia, and more. Given their medical background, psychiatrists can prescribe medication, though they might likewise utilize psychiatric therapy and other restorative strategies.

The expense of seeing a private psychiatrist can vary significantly based on location, experience, and specific services. Typically, session fees range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 per see. It's also vital to inspect if the psychiatrist accepts insurance and what part of the costs will be covered.

A: If you're experiencing persistent unhappiness, stress and anxiety, state of mind swings, or any emotional distress that impacts day-to-day life, it might be advantageous to speak with a psychiatrist.
Q2: What should I anticipate throughout my first visit?
A: The first visit normally involves discussing your medical history, present symptoms, and treatment objectives. This may include an assessment that results in a diagnosis and possible treatment suggestions.
Q3: Can a psychiatrist prescribe medication?
A: Yes, psychiatrists can recommend medication as part of a treatment plan.
Q4: How long do visits normally last?
A: Initial consultations normally last in between 45 to 60 minutes, while follow-up check outs may vary from 15 to 30 minutes.
Q5: What if I do not feel comfy with my psychiatrist?
A: It's crucial to feel comfortable and understood. If the relationship is not a great fit, looking for a various psychiatrist is advisable.
Q6: Are there specialized psychiatrists for particular conditions?
A: Yes, some psychiatrists concentrate on specific areas, such as kid psychiatry, geriatric psychiatry, or dependency psychiatry, which can be useful if you have particular requirements.
